lie <br /> 1. Planning Division: <br /> a . Final elevations within 25 feet of any property boundary <br /> must be equal to or greater than the abutting property <br /> unless the elevation prior to excavation is less than that <br /> of the abutting property, in which case the differential <br /> shall not be increased. <br /> b. Final slopes cannot exceed 1-1/2 feet horizontal to 1 foot <br /> vertical . <br /> c . All water utilized in the plant operation must be disposed <br /> of behind a closed dike. <br /> d. Stockpiled soil or material cannot be stored within 25 <br /> feet of a property boundary. <br /> e. Private roads involved in the excavation must be main- <br /> tained to control the creation of dust. The first 100 <br /> feet of any private road on the property which intersects <br /> with a publicly maintained road must be surfaced in a <br /> manner approved by the agency responsible for the main- <br /> tenance of the public road. Traffic-control and warning <br /> signs are required at the intersection. The placement, <br /> size, and wording of these signs must be approved by the <br /> agency responsible for the maintenance of the public road. <br /> f . Excavation operations shall not be carried on during the <br /> hours from 9 : 00 p.m. through 5 : 00 a.m. , except during <br /> periods of dedlared national , state or local emergency. <br /> The hours shall be based on either Pacific Standard Time <br /> or Pacific Daylight Saving Time, whichever is legally in <br /> effect. <br /> g . Any night lighting established on the property must be <br /> arranged and controlled so it will not illuminate or cause <br /> any glare onto public rights-of-way or adjacent proper- <br /> ties. <br /> h . All emissions are subject to the rules and regulations of <br /> the San Joaquin Air Pollution Control District . <br /> i . Operations shall be in accordance with instructions from <br /> the Agricultural Commissioner to control the spread of <br /> noxious weeds. <br /> j . The excavation must not cause health or sanitary hazards <br /> and shall not create conditions which will cause the <br /> breeding or increase of mosquitoes, rodents, or other <br /> pests. <br /> k. The operating practices utilized must minimize noise, <br /> vibration, dust, and unsightliness . <br /> QX-89-3 (ALEGRE) -4- RES #90-301 <br />
